NOVELTY - Treating heavy metal wastewater involves mixing adsorption material with heavy metal wastewater, and using a magnetic separation method to separate the adsorption material from the wastewater. The adsorption material includes a substrate layer, where the substrate layer is graphene oxide, flake boron nitride, and boron nitride aerogel. A functional layer is provided for covering the surface of the substrate layer. The functional layer has a thickness of 7-8 nm. The functional layer is a polydopamine film modified with 3-aminopropyltriethoxysilane. The magnetic particles are distributed between the base layer and the functional layer, where the magnetic particles are ferroferric oxide and elemental nickel. The magnetic particles have a particle size of 1-50 nm. USE - Method for treating heavy metal wastewater. ADVANTAGE - The method treats the heavy metal wastewater in a simple, cost-effective and eco-friendly manner with high-efficiency water purification.
